    1. Matilda is 3 but I've tried to do make creativity a part of her daily play with her since she was quite small really. One thing I think is really great is clay play. A lump of clay to feel and squidge and you could give her some bits to press into the clay, such as stones, shells, sticks, gems, sequins etc. There's always finger paint and playdoh. Really great as sensory play, too.
